Crown Cottage is nestled in the heart of Eastbourne's historic Old Town, a charming conservation area that has retained much of its original village character. Long before Eastbourne became a popular seaside resort, Old Town was the centre of the local community, and today its tree-lined streets, period cottages and independent businesses make it one of the town's most desirable places to stay.
Just around the corner, you'll find a wonderful selection of independent cafés, bakeries, local shops and traditional pubs, including The Lamb and The Rainbow, both less than a two-minute walk from the cottage. Whether you're looking for a leisurely breakfast, a freshly brewed coffee or a cosy pub meal, everything is within easy walking distance.
Old Town is also home to the beautiful St Mary's Church, with parts of the building dating back to the 12th century, and the picturesque Motcombe Gardens, a peaceful green space featuring a duck pond, ornamental gardens and a café. It's the perfect place for a relaxing stroll or a quiet afternoon.
For walkers and nature lovers, the South Downs National Park is just moments away, offering spectacular countryside, rolling hills and scenic walking routes leading towards Beachy Head and the iconic Seven Sisters cliffs.
Although Old Town enjoys a peaceful village atmosphere, you're only a 10-minute walk from Eastbourne town centre and the railway station, making it easy to enjoy the town's theatres, seafront, shopping and excellent transport links while returning to the tranquillity and charm of this unique historic neighbourhood.
